A close view of the port bow of the British India Steam Navigation Company cargo liner Bombala (1961) loading wool at Sydney, New South Wales. The photographer is on the quayside looking up at a metal frame which has 12 bales of wool hooked onto it as it is being hoisted aboard the ship. The frame has D.I.S. & Co. on it. the heads of three men are in the foreground. Negatives PM1791/5 to PM1791/7 were taken on the same occasion.
